An acclaimed reporter takes us on an unforgettable journey, capturing the human capacity for love and connection against all odds.

We live in an era defined by crisis—whether it be war and displacement, climate collapse, or growing inequality, and how the powerful profit from violence and exploitation. Celebrated foreign correspondent Sally Hayden has spent her career on the frontlines, uncovering some of the darkest moments of our time. Yet even in the face of unimaginable adversity, she’s witnessed the incredible goodness of regular people.

In This Is Also a Love Story, Hayden reexamines catastrophe through the love stories she has come across. She introduces us to a mother in northeast Nigeria who risks everything to save her daughter from forced marriage to Boko Haram militants, and to a group of Syrian women who have tirelessly searched for their missing spouses and children, while launching a call for justice. We meet a couple separated by the Russian invasion of Ukraine and read letters from the bereaved to the dead, still being written over a decade after the tsunami that devastated Japan. Through these stories, which crisscross the globe, from Uganda to Lebanon, Ghana, Rwanda and Iraq, she challenges us to reconsider what it means to be alive on this planet today.

What if news was recounted through the prism of the actions and decisions people take for those they love? Would it become harder to dehumanize those who seem different to us? This Is Also a Love Story dares us to recognize how innate generosity and self-sacrifice can be found in even the most difficult of times, and—as a result—to question what might be needed to create a better world.

Recensioni della critica

"A brilliant piece of work that proves love can survive war."
"Journalists are trained to look for and deliver facts, and Irish reporter Hayden did that, but she also did something more: She looked for love amid war. Narrator Aoife McMahon, with her delightful Irish accent, brings us the stories Hayden found while reporting the news. She explores war's impact on people and their relationships. She tells stories of the courageous soldier in Ukraine who confesses discomfort during his home visits and queer people in Ghana, where their love could have deadly consequences. From battle-scarred countries the world over, including Uganda, Iraq, and Rwanda, McMahon relates these stories with a beautiful dignity. They reveal terror and horror but also unexpected love, compassion, and survival."
